Scope and Contents
"The new temple was a completely closed 35 x 59m wide and 12.5m high building with one front entrance and two side doors. The uniformity of the enormous wall surfaces was disrupted only by huge lion-headed water spouts, three along the side walls and two in the rear wall." [Arnold D., 1999: Temples of the Last Pharaohs. Oxford University Press]. This photograph was taken when Eliot Elisofon was on assignment for American Institute of Architects, directing the Egyptian portion of the documentary on Ancient Egypt, March 1965 and September 1965.
